I am PSoC4 beginner, so I am a little confusing about ECO. When I read PSoC4 datasheet and it explain XTAL24I can input 24-MHz crystal or external clock input. But a diagram in the datasheet show crystal is only connected at XTAL24I pin. Therefore, I suspect if I can input external clock signal into XTAL24I pin.

   

Please tell me whether I  can connect external clock signal into XTAL24I pin or not.
